About The Course

This course covers all the basics of building science, including air leakage and energy transfer, insulation, moisture, indoor air quality, lighting and appliances, combustion safety and more. You also get the business perspective as applied to home performance contractors.

Why Take This Course

  • Learn how various components of the home interact to affect the home’s overall performance.
  • Understand the relationship between the building envelope, heating, A/C, insulation, mechanical ventilation, lighting, appliances and the home's other systems.
  • Learn how all of these systems affect the comfort, health and safety of occupants and durability of the home.
  • Discover why improving the energy efficiency of the home is the first step toward solar, geothermal or other renewable energy improvements.
  • You will be able to work with homeowners to improve their comfort and safety, and reduce their energy bills.
  • Pass the optional BPI exam and earn your BPI Building Science certificate to add to your qualifications and credibility (exam fees extra).
